  • In this video, I share my experience with an amazing, 30-Year-Old lens from Canon, the 35-350mm f/3.5-5.6 L. Bang-for-buck it's the best lens to use for event coverage and travel!
    This lens can be found on eBay for as little as $400 in mint condition.

    The optical performance is better than I expected from an old superzoom. That is a pretty neat find. The ability to get really close with the lens is also stunning for pseudo-macro.
    For flying without checked bags, the size of the lens and weight of the lens isn't as nice. Something like the 12-100mm or 12-200mm by Olympus (read: 24-200mm and 24-400mm in 135 format angle of view) is more travel-sized. Plus, I could throw in an f/1.8 or f/1.2 prime for low light and still be able to pack more than if I flew with the 35-350.

    Some of these old lenses are great. I shoot a lot of vintage glass that is pushing 70 years old. If you know the lens design, correcting for distorting and CA is easy. The best part about the older Canon lenses is that the correction data is built right into some processing software packages.
